Angélica María Cepeda Jiménez (born on August 2, 1974), known as Angie Cepeda, is a talented actress from Colombia. She is famous for her roles in TV shows like Pobre Diabla. She also starred in movies such as Captain Pantoja and the Special Services and Love in the Time of Cholera. Angie is the younger sister of another well-known actress, Lorna Cepeda.
Early Life
Angie Cepeda was born in Cartagena de Indias, a city in Colombia. She grew up in Barranquilla. After her parents separated, she lived with her mother. She also lived with her two older sisters. One of her sisters is the actress Lorna Paz.
Becoming an Actress
Angie decided she wanted to be an actress. She moved to Bogotá to study drama. Soon after starting her acting classes, a beer company hired her. She appeared in several of their advertisements.
After that, she started getting small parts. She acted in different TV shows and movies in Colombia. Her big break came with the TV show Las Juanas. This role helped her get noticed by TV producers.
She then got leading roles in popular shows. These included Luz María in 1998. She also played Fiorella Morelli in Pobre Diabla in 2000.
In 2021, Angie Cepeda lent her voice to a special character. She voiced Julieta Madrigal in the Disney animated movie Encanto. She did the voice for the English, Spanish, and Italian versions of the film. This made her voice known to many young fans around the world.
Notable Works
Angie Cepeda has appeared in many movies and TV shows. Some of her well-known roles include:
- Las Juanas (1997) – A popular TV series.
- Luz María (1998) – Where she played the main character.
- Pobre diabla (2000) – Another leading role in a TV series.
- Pantaleón y las visitadoras (1999) – A film where she played La Colombiana.
- Love in the Time of Cholera (2006) – A movie based on a famous book.
- Los protegidos (2010-2012) – A Spanish TV series.
- Pablo Escobar, El Patrón del Mal (2012) – A TV series where she played Regina Parejo.
- Encanto (2021) – As the voice of Julieta Madrigal.
Awards and Recognition
Angie Cepeda has received awards for her acting. In 2004, she won the Best Actress award. This was at the Viña del Mar Film Festival for her role in the movie Sammy y yo. She has also been nominated for other awards. These nominations show that her acting is highly valued.
